[30] The EP contained covers of Rose Tattoo's "Nice Boys" and Aerosmith's "Mama Kin", along with two original compositions: the punk-influenced "Reckless Life" and the classic rock-inspired "Move to the City". Rob Gardner, international man of mystery Rob Gardner/Facebook As Ultimate Classic Rock tells us, the original 1985 lineup of the band called Guns N' Roses was more than a little different from the classic lineup of the 1990s: Axl Rose, Tracii Guns, Izzy Stradlin, Ole Beich, and Rob Gardner. After a decade of work, Guns N' Roses's long-awaited sixth studio album, Chinese Democracy (2008), was released, featuring the title track as lead single. [374][375], In early 2012, the band announced the upcoming Up Close and Personal Tour, with shows in the United States and Europe. When they signed to Geffen Records in 1986, the band comprised vocalist Axl Rose, lead guitarist Slash, rhythm guitarist Izzy Stradlin, bassist Duff McKagan, and drummer Steven Adler. GUNS N' ROSES kicked off their 2023 tour earlier today (Thursday, June 1) in Abu Dhabi, the capital of the United Arab Emirates, at the prestigious Etihad Arena, the largest indoor multi-purpose venue in the UAE, with a seating capacity of over 20,000. [358], On December 7, 2011, it was announced that the classic Guns N' Roses lineup was to be inducted into the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ame, along with several other acts, including the Red Hot Chili Peppers and The Faces. [379], On August 13, 2012, the band announced a residency at The Joint in Las Vegas entitled "Appetite for Democracy", celebrating the 25th anniversary of Appetite for Destruction and the fourth anniversary of Chinese Democracy. [208] The band played both songs from previous albums and songs from then-unreleased Chinese Democracy. [380][381] On November 21, 2012, the band's performance in Vegas was taped in 3D and was screened across theaters in 2014 before being released as Appetite for Democracy 3D on July 1, 2014. Following the expansive Chinese Democracy Tour, Slash and McKagan rejoined the band in 2016 for the Not in This Lifetime Tour, which became the third-highest-grossing concert tour on record, grossing over $584 million by its conclusion in 2019. As the Drummers' Journal tells us, Freese is a noted session drummer who had a two-year contract with GN'R from 1998 to 2000, but chose not to renew it because the band was pretty much buried in the studio abyss at the time. According to Blabbermouth, Stradlin's only band after his GN'R tenure was the short-lived Izzy Stradlin &The Ju Ju Hounds, after which he released 10 solo albums (the last of which came out in 2010).
